Topics Covered
- 1. Introduction to Static Code Analysis: Learners will study the basics of static code analysis, including its importance in software development and the principles behind it. They will gain skills in using static code analysis tools and understanding their outputs.
- 2. Static Analysis Techniques and Methods: This module covers various techniques and methods used in static code analysis, such as control flow analysis, data flow analysis, and abstract interpretation. Learners will learn how to apply these techniques to identify potential issues in code.
- 3. Static Code Analysis for Common Coding Issues: Focusing on common coding issues like null pointer exceptions, type mismatches, and resource leaks, learners will explore how static code analysis can help prevent these issues. Practical skills include using tools to detect and fix these problems.
- 4. Static Analysis for Security Vulnerabilities: This module delves into identifying security vulnerabilities in legacy code using static analysis. Learners will learn about various security threats and how static analysis can be used to mitigate them.
- 5. Refactoring Techniques for Legacy Code: An introduction to refactoring techniques specifically tailored for legacy code. Learners will learn how static code analysis can guide the refactoring process to improve code quality and maintainability.
- 6. Advanced Static Analysis Tools and Frameworks: This module provides an in-depth look at advanced tools and frameworks for static code analysis, such as SonarQube and Pylint. Learners will gain hands-on experience with these tools and understand how to integrate them into development workflows.
- 7. Static Analysis in Continuous Integration Pipelines: Learners will explore how static code analysis can be integrated into continuous integration (CI) pipelines to automate the code quality assurance process. Skills include setting up and configuring CI tools for static analysis.
- 8. Case Studies in Static Code Analysis for Legacy Code Refactoring: Through real-world case studies, learners will analyze and refactor legacy code using static code analysis techniques. They will learn best practices and strategies for effective legacy code refactoring.
- 9. Performance Analysis and Optimization: This module focuses on using static code analysis to identify performance bottlenecks in legacy applications. Learners will learn how to optimize code for better performance without compromising functionality.
- 10. Reporting and Communicating Findings from Static Code Analysis: In this final module, learners will learn how to effectively report and communicate findings from static code analysis to development teams. Skills include creating actionable reports and presenting analysis results in a clear and concise manner.
